Between the sniffling and sneezing this weekend I did a little winter pruning in the front yard. At least I thought it was just a little until I went outside this morning to warm the car up before I took the baby bassets to school. While the car warms up I like to inspect the garden and take mental notes on future plantings. In my head I just cleared out a few weeds and trimmed back a few overgrown Lamb’s ears. I must have had my eyes shut while I was trimming because it looks like I had a vendetta against the poor plants. There are huge bald spots where plants used to be, and I could have sworn this morning I could hear plants crying from the bad haircuts I gave them. DOWN TO THE BASE OF THE PLANT! Was I mad yesterday? It’ll grow back. Right? I was trimming like it’s the end of winter and not the beginning. I might need to make a few little coats if I want them to make it through the next frost. It’s always all or nothing with me. Sorry little plant buddies!

In the summer of 1955, nine-year-old Amanda Gerber tearfully leaves her best friend, Francine, and their adventurous life on her block in Brooklyn’s Flatbush. She joins her cantankerous family on the long, hot drive to her grandmother’s home in the Catskill Mountains among the city’s Jews who flock to countless hotels and bungalow colonies in the heyday of the Borscht Belt. In the idyllic mountains, Amanda becomes ensconced in the tumult of her extended family and their friends, often seeking solace in the woods with her beloved cousin Laura.

Through the following summers, interspersed with the heightened drama of her emotionally charged city life, Mandy faces severe tests to her survival mechanisms, including the pain of loss, abuse, and betrayal, while family secrets threaten to disrupt her life even further. A novel-in-stories, Floating in the Neversink is a testament to the power of survival, friendship, and love.
